    The residential real estate market in Cornelius, NC, has shown consistent growth over the past few years. According to recent data from the National Association of Realtors, home prices in Cornelius have increased by an average of 10% annually. This trend is expected to continue as more people move to the area in search of affordable housing near major cities.

    In 2023, the median home price in Cornelius was approximately $450,000, with luxury properties exceeding $1 million. The market is driven by a combination of first-time buyers, growing families, and retirees looking for a peaceful lifestyle. The demand for homes in Cornelius is further fueled by its reputation as a safe and family-friendly community.

    Top Neighborhoods in Cornelius

    Cornelius, NC, is home to several neighborhoods that cater to different lifestyles and preferences. From suburban communities to lakefront developments, there's something for everyone in this town. Below are some of the top neighborhoods in Cornelius:

  • 1. Birkdale Village

    Birkdale Village is a mixed-use development that combines residential, commercial, and recreational spaces. This neighborhood offers a vibrant community atmosphere with shops, restaurants, and parks within walking distance. Homes in Birkdale Village range from townhomes to single-family residences, making it a popular choice for young professionals and families.

    2. Lake Norman Shores

    Lake Norman Shores is a waterfront community that offers stunning views and easy access to water-based activities. This neighborhood is ideal for those who enjoy boating, fishing, and other outdoor pursuits. Properties here are typically more expensive due to their prime location and luxurious amenities.

    Financing Options for Cornelius Real Estate

    Financing is a critical aspect of buying or investing in residential real estate. Cornelius buyers have access to various financing options, including traditional mortgages, FHA loans, and VA loans. Below are some of the most popular financing options for Cornelius real estate:

    Traditional Mortgages

    Traditional mortgages are the most common type of home loan. They typically require a 20% down payment and offer fixed or adjustable interest rates. Borrowers with good credit scores and stable incomes are often eligible for favorable terms.

    FHA Loans

    FHA loans are government-backed mortgages that require a lower down payment and are ideal for first-time buyers. These loans are insured by the Federal Housing Administration and offer more flexible credit requirements.

    Tax Considerations for Homeowners in Cornelius

    Owning a home in Cornelius comes with certain tax implications that buyers should be aware of. Property taxes in Cornelius are based on the assessed value of your home and are used to fund local services such as schools, parks, and infrastructure. Understanding these taxes can help you budget effectively and avoid surprises.

    Property Tax Rates in Cornelius

    As of 2023, the property tax rate in Cornelius is approximately 0.85% of the assessed value of your home. This rate is subject to change based on local government decisions and economic conditions. It's important to factor property taxes into your overall budget when purchasing a home in Cornelius.
